Goalkeeper Performance Comparison

NYCFC Goalkeeper Analysis

NYCFC's goalkeeper has been a crucial part of their recent success. Let's examine the numbers:

  • Number of saves in recent matches: Averaging 4 saves per game over the last five matches.
  • Clean sheet percentage: A solid 40% clean sheet rate in recent games.
  • Goals conceded per game average: Conceding an average of 1.2 goals per game.
  • Overall rating from reputable sources: WhoScored gives him an average rating of 7.2 over the last five matches.

Toronto FC Goalkeeper Analysis

Toronto FC's goalkeeper has faced a tougher run of fixtures. Here's a look at his statistics:

  • Number of saves in recent matches: Averaging 3.5 saves per game.
  • Clean sheet percentage: A lower 30% clean sheet rate.
  • Goals conceded per game average: Conceding an average of 1.5 goals per game.
  • Overall rating from reputable sources: WhoScored rates him at 6.8 over the same period.

Direct Comparison

While both goalkeepers have performed admirably, NYCFC's goalkeeper edges out his Toronto FC counterpart in terms of clean sheets and overall rating, suggesting slightly stronger performance based on available data.

Defensive Line Analysis (NYCFC vs Toronto FC)

NYCFC Defensive Performance

NYCFC's defense has been relatively robust in recent games:

  • Tackles won per game: Averaging 12 tackles won per game.
  • Interceptions per game: Recording an average of 8 interceptions per game.
  • Individual player ratings (e.g., from WhoScored, ESPN): Key defenders consistently receive ratings above 7.0 from WhoScored.

Toronto FC Defensive Performance

Toronto's defense has shown vulnerability in recent matches:

  • Tackles won per game: Averaging 10 tackles per game.
  • Interceptions per game: Recording an average of 6 interceptions per game.
  • Individual player ratings (e.g., from WhoScored, ESPN): Key defenders have seen ratings fluctuate, with some falling below the 7.0 mark.

Comparative Analysis

NYCFC's defensive line shows more consistency and higher ratings, suggesting a more reliable backline compared to Toronto FC.
